There is no direct connection from Machu Picchu to Tiwanaku. However, you can take the bus to Aguas Calientes, walk to Machu Picchu Pueblo, take the train to Ave. El Sol 843 , Cusco, walk to Cusco Bus Station, take the bus to Puno, take the bus to Terminal de Buses Desaguadero, then take the taxi to Tiwanaku. Alternatively, you can drive from Machu Picchu to Tiwanaku in around 13h 49m.
